Product Overview

Category

IFX25001TC V85 belongs to the category of integrated circuits (ICs).

Use

It is primarily used for power management applications.

Characteristics

  • High efficiency
  • Low power consumption
  • Compact size
  • Wide operating voltage range

Package

IFX25001TC V85 is available in a small outline package (SOP) with a specified pin configuration.

Essence

The essence of IFX25001TC V85 lies in its ability to efficiently manage power in various electronic devices.

Packaging/Quantity

IFX25001TC V85 is typically packaged in reels and comes in quantities of 2500 units per reel.

Specifications

  • Input Voltage Range: 4.5V - 40V
  • Output Voltage Range: 1.2V - 37V
  • Maximum Output Current: 1.5A
  • Operating Temperature Range: -40°C to +125°C

Detailed Pin Configuration

IFX25001TC V85 has the following pin configuration:

  1. VIN: Input voltage pin
  2. GND: Ground pin
  3. EN: Enable pin
  4. FB: Feedback pin
  5. SW: Switch pin
  6. VOUT: Output voltage pin

Functional Features

  • Wide input voltage range allows for versatile applications
  • High efficiency ensures minimal power loss
  • Overcurrent protection safeguards the circuit from damage
  • Thermal shutdown protection prevents overheating
  • Soft start feature reduces inrush current during startup

Advantages and Disadvantages

Advantages

  • High efficiency leads to energy savings
  • Compact size enables integration into space-constrained designs
  • Wide operating voltage range provides flexibility in different applications

Disadvantages

  • Limited maximum output current may not be suitable for high-power applications
  • Requires external components for proper operation

Working Principles

IFX25001TC V85 operates as a step-down (buck) converter. It takes the input voltage and efficiently converts it to a lower output voltage, which can be adjusted within the specified range. The integrated circuit regulates the output voltage by controlling the duty cycle of the internal switch.

Detailed Application Field Plans

IFX25001TC V85 finds applications in various fields, including but not limited to: - Consumer electronics - Automotive systems - Industrial automation - Telecommunications

Detailed and Complete Alternative Models

Some alternative models that offer similar functionality to IFX25001TC V85 are: - LM2596 - LT1073 - TPS5430

These models provide comparable power management capabilities and can be considered as alternatives based on specific requirements.
